How to fix Gotv Decoder not Showing Green Light

If your GOtv decoder is not showing a green light, it may indicate a power or connectivity issue. Here are some troubleshooting steps you can follow:

1. Check Power Connection: Ensure that the power cable is securely plugged into both the GOtv decoder and a working power outlet. Confirm that the power outlet is functioning by connecting another device to it.

2. Power On/Off: Press the power button on the GOtv decoder or use the remote control to power it on. If the decoder doesn’t respond, try unplugging the power cable, waiting for a few seconds, and then plugging it back in to perform a power cycle.

3. Check Cables and Connections: Ensure that all cables connecting the GOtv decoder to the TV and the antenna are securely plugged in. Verify that the cables are not damaged or frayed. If necessary, try using different cables to see if it resolves the issue.

4. Antenna Signal: Check the connection between the antenna and the GOtv decoder. Ensure that the antenna cable is properly connected to the RF IN or ANT IN port on the decoder. You may also want to check the antenna position and alignment to ensure a strong signal.

5. Remote Control: Make sure the batteries in the remote control are working properly. Try replacing the batteries and check if the green light on the decoder responds when pressing the power button on the remote.

6. Decoder Reset: If none of the above steps work, you can try resetting the GOtv decoder. Look for a small reset button (usually located on the back or side of the decoder) and press it using a pin or a paperclip. Hold the button for a few seconds until the decoder restarts.

If you have tried all these troubleshooting steps and the green light still doesn’t appear on the decoder, it may indicate a technical issue with the decoder itself. In that case, it’s recommended to contact the GOtv customer care helpline or visit their official website for further assistance and support. They will be able to provide specific troubleshooting steps or guide you on how to get the decoder repaired or replaced if needed.
